What If a College Football Team Goes Undefeated?
If a college football team goes undefeated, it is an impressive accomplishment that often leads to recognition and accolades. The team may be invited to compete in a prestigious bowl game or even the College Football Playoff, depending on their ranking and the strength of their schedule.
However, there is no guarantee that an undefeated team will win the national championship. The selection process for the College Football Playoff involves a committee that evaluates the overall performance and strength of schedule of each team. Other factors, such as conference championships and head-to-head matchups, also play a role in determining the final playoff participants.
In some cases, an undefeated team may be left out of the playoff altogether, causing controversy and debate among fans and analysts. This highlights the subjective nature of college football rankings and the complexities of determining a true national champion.
